I’ve just received my bill from Castle Water for my water usage at work - 1 day before the due date.

For the period April 2021 to September 2021 it’s about £120 now, up from just under £80 for the same period last year. I only have a single cold water tap and a toilet here so my usage is very low.

I have a meter here and looking at the fine details my bill is based on an estimated usage of 23 (whatever that means). The estimated usage for the same period last year was 6.

I’m a bit confused but have paid it so that I don’t incur any late payment charges, like I did over the winter.

I had an interesting experience when I dusted off the cobwebs and other debris from my (outside) water meter and found that it actually read much lower than the number that the last bill was based on. I thought my bills had been a bit high, so I did some detective work and found that the previous bill was an estimate and the one before that was an incorrect reading ( my logic based on looking at the one before that!) - probably a dyslexic meter reader or simply the wrong house (I live on a corner plot). I discussed my findings with the Southern Water Customer Service, who I persuaded, after a little friendly but professional negotiation that I was absolutely correct and hey Presto! got a £345 refund. Worth keeping an eye on these things.
